Market Research
Understanding the market environment, including customer needs, competitor activities, and industry trends.
Defining Objectives
Setting clear, measurable marketing goals aligned with the overall business objectives. These goals could range from increasing market share and improving brand awareness to launching new products and entering new markets.
Segmentation and Targeting
Dividing the broader market into smaller segments based on various criteria such as demographics, psychographics, and behavior. Then, selecting the most appropriate segments to target.
Positioning
Developing a unique value proposition and positioning statement that differentiates the brand or product in the minds of the target audience.
Marketing Mix (4 Ps)
Planning the marketing mix elements – Product, Price, Place, and Promotion – to create a cohesive strategy that delivers value to customers.
Implementation
Executing the marketing plan through coordinated efforts across various channels and touchpoints. This involves managing resources, timelines, and budgets effectively.
Monitoring and Evaluation
Continuously tracking the performance of marketing activities against the set objectives. This includes analyzing metrics and KPIs, gathering feedback, and making necessary adjustments to improve outcomes.
